#44CA6C Color
#44CA6C is rgb(68, 202, 108) in RGB, hsl(138, 56%, 53%) in HSL, and about cmyk(66%, 0%, 47%, 21%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Emerald (#50C878),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.64.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#44CA6C Channel Values
How #44CA6C bre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 68 · G 202 · B 108 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 138° · S 56% · L 53%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 138° · S 66% · V 79%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 66% · M 0% · Y 47% · K 21%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.12:1 vs white · 9.91: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#44CA6C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#44CA6C?
#44CA6C is a mid-tone green — rgb(68, 202, 108) in RGB and hsl(138, 56%, 53%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Emerald (#50C878),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.64.
What is the RGB value of #44CA6C?
#44CA6C is rgb(68, 202, 108) — red 68, green 202, and blue 108 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#44CA6C?
#44CA6C converts to approximately cmyk(66%, 0%, 47%, 21%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#44CA6C be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#44CA6C scores 2.12:1 against white and 9.91: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#44CA6C as a CSS color keyword?
No. #44CA6C is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umseagreen (#3CB371) at a CIE76 distance of 15.77, which is visibly different.
